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.

NVD · unedited
ORBit and esound in Red Hat Linux 6.1 do not use sufficiently random numbers, which allows local users to guess the authentication keys.

Technical summary Written by usOur analysis, written from the advisory, the CVSS vector and the affected-version data. It adds context the advisory leaves out, and never invents facts that are not in the source.

dbcve analysis · moderate confidence

ORBit and esound in Red Hat Linux 6.1 use insufficiently random numbers for authentication key generation, allowing local users to brute-force or guess the keys and potentially gain unauthorized access to these services.

MitigationThis is a legacy vulnerability in Red Hat Linux 6.1 (circa 2000). Modern systems are not affected. For any remaining legacy deployments, upgrade to supported software versions and ensure cryptographic random number generation is used for authentication keys.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Identify the installed operating system version
    Run 'cat /etc/redhat-release' or 'cat /etc/issue' to check the OS version
    Affected if The system is not Red Hat Linux 6.1 (modern systems are not affected)
  2. Check if ORBit is installed
    Run 'rpm -q ORBit' or 'rpm -qa | grep -i orbit' to query the RPM package database
    Affected if ORBit package is installed on Red Hat Linux 6.1 and the service is in use
  3. Check if esound is installed
    Run 'rpm -q esound' or 'rpm -qa | grep -i esound' to query the RPM package database
    Affected if esound package is installed on Red Hat Linux 6.1 and the service is in use
  4. Determine if affected services are running
    Run 'ps aux | grep -E "(orbit|esd)"' to check if ORBit or esound daemons are active
    Affected if ORBit or esound services are running on a vulnerable Red Hat Linux 6.1 system

A user is affected only if running Red Hat Linux 6.1 with ORBit or esound packages installed and services enabled, as the vulnerability requires these specific packages on this exact OS version to be exploitable.
